Discover the Charm of Brocante de Saint-Pholien

Brocante de Saint-Pholien is a captivating destination nestled in the heart of Liège, Belgium, renowned for its eclectic assortment of antiques and vintage items. As you step into this enchanting market, you are greeted by the warm ambiance of history, where each corner is filled with charming relics waiting to be discovered. The variety is astounding, with everything from vintage furniture and decorative arts to rare collectibles and unique trinkets, making it a haven for collectors and those searching for one-of-a-kind souvenirs. Exploring the Brocante is not just about shopping; it is an experience that allows you to imm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of the region. The market is usually bustling with activity, where local vendors share stories behind their items, adding layers of meaning to your finds. As you meander through the stalls, take your time to appreciate the craftsmanship and the narratives woven into each piece. Whether you are a seasoned antique lover or a curious traveler, the allure of Brocante de Saint-Pholien will surely leave you enchanted. Visiting this market offers a fantastic opportunity to connect with local culture, make new friends, and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ere that characterizes Liège. Remember to bring cash, as many vendors prefer it, and don’t hesitate to haggle for the best prices. A visit to Brocante de Saint-Pholien is not just shopping; it’s a delightful dive into a world of nostalgia and artistic expression.

Local tips

  • Arrive early to get the best selections before the crowds arrive.
  • Bring cash as many vendors may not accept credit cards.
  • Don’t hesitate to negotiate prices; bargaining is common here.
  • Take breaks at nearby cafes to enjoy some local cuisine.
  • Check for special events or themed markets that might be taking place during your visit.
